In conclusion, when the cleaning device for the agricultural greenhouse is used, the connecting frame 6 and the protective shell 7 are driven to move up and down through the electric telescopic rod 2, the height of the cleaning roller 10 inside the protective shell 7 is adjusted, so that the top of the cleaning roller 10 is attached to the top of the greenhouse, the driving shaft 8 and the cleaning roller 10 are driven to rotate through the driving motor 9 to clean the top of the greenhouse, the water pump 5 sprays cleaning water through the spray heads on the inner sides of the cleaning water pipes 14 through the connecting pipes to clean the cleaning roller 10 and the top of the greenhouse, in addition, the driving shaft 8 and the cleaning roller 10 are pressed through the compression springs 16 on the left side and the right side, a certain pressure is formed between the top of the cleaning roller 10 and the greenhouse, the cleaning effect is improved, the cleaning blades 12 movably sleeved on the two sides of the protective shell 7 scrape the cleaning water remained on the top of the greenhouse when the, the universal wheels at the bottom of the device push the device to clean all parts of the top of the greenhouse.

The utility model provides a belt cleaning device for green house, includes unable adjustment base (1), its characterized in that: the top of the fixed base (1) is fixedly provided with an electric telescopic rod (2), the top end of the electric telescopic rod (2) is fixedly provided with a connecting frame (6), the top of the connecting frame (6) is fixedly provided with a protective shell (7), a driving shaft (8) is movably sleeved on the inner side of the protective shell (7), a cleaning roller (10) positioned in the protective shell (7) is fixedly sleeved outside the driving shaft (8), two clamping frames (11) are fixedly arranged at the left side and the right side of the protective shell (7), a limiting block (15) is clamped in the clamping frame (11), a compression spring (16) is fixedly arranged at the bottom of the limiting block (15), the two ends of the driving shaft (8) are clamped at the top of the limiting block (15), the left end of the driving shaft (8) is fixedly provided with a driving motor (9), and cleaning water pipes (14) are fixedly arranged on the front side and the rear side inside the protective shell (7).

The cleaning device for the agricultural greenhouse of claim 1, wherein: the cleaning roller is characterized in that soft bristles which are uniformly distributed are fixedly arranged on the outer portion of the cleaning roller (10) inside the protective shell (7), two cleaning water pipes (14) inside the protective shell (7) are distributed on two sides of the cleaning roller (10) in a mirror image mode, and spray heads which are uniformly distributed are fixedly arranged on the inner side of each cleaning water pipe (14).
4. The cleaning device for the agricultural greenhouse of claim 1, wherein: the inner side of the top end of the protective shell (7) is fixedly provided with two fixed shafts, the outer parts of the two fixed shafts are movably provided with two scraping plates (12), the outer parts of the fixed shafts are movably sleeved with torsion springs (13), one ends of the torsion springs (13) are fixedly connected with the scraping plates (12), and the other ends of the torsion springs (13) are fixedly connected with the fixed shafts.
